Harley is one of the cats in our care, keeping his paws crossed for a forever home in 2019.

Harley is a very sweet young man looking for a very special someone to offer him a loving forever home.

He was sadly returned to us in February 2018 as his previous owner was no longer able to cope with his day to day care.

Harley had developed an intestinal upset, which kept the vets completely bamboozled, after numerous tests, and visits to the specialist no one was able to determine the cause of the problem.

However, a course of treatment was suggested which we are pleased to say seems to have done the trick.

Harley will still require a gastrointe­stinal diet indefinite­ly, but he has been medication free for months now without any problems just the odd loose stool every now and then.

Despite all he has been through, Harley remains the most loving, affectiona­te little man.

He isn’t much of a lap cat, but loves a cuddle at bedtime where he will often come and lie on you or next to you but rarely sits on the sofa. He loves head tickles and having his back rubbed.

Grooming is an absolute favourite, he will often follow you around the house when you’re at home keeping a close check on what you’re up to simply enjoying being in your company.

He is very playful and loves being able to explore the outside world so a garden is going to be essential.

Harley isn’t keen on being picked up even now, but the better he knows you the more trusting he will be and he will tolerate it more and more.

He is looking for a home with adult owners, as the only pet, and will be happy amusing himself whilst you’re at work as long as he has a cat flap to get out and about.
